Leeds: Orta submits Mikelbrencis bid

Leeds United are interested in a deal to bring William Mikelbrencis to Elland Road in the summer transfer window.

What’s the talk?

That’s according to a claim made by Loic Tanzi, with the L’Equipe journalist revealing in a recent post on Twitter that, as well as 2. Bundesliga side Hamburger SV, Victor Orta has now submitted an official bid for the FC Metz right-back.

However, Tanzi goes on to suggest that, should the 18-year-old opt for a move to Germany ahead of one to the Premier League, he would have an immediate place in the Hamburger starting XI, while first-team opportunities would likely be much more limited at Elland Road.

In his post, the journalist said: “Leeds have also made an offer but in Hamburger, William Mikelbrencis will have a place as soon as he arrives in the first team.”

The next Aarons

Considering just how promising a talent Mikelbrencis evidently is, in addition to the fact that Orta is well-known for his desire to bring the most exciting youth prospects to Elland Road – as evidenced by his signings of both Sonny Perkins and Darko Gyabi in the current transfer window – it is not hard to understand why the Spaniard would be keen on a move for the 18-year-old.

Indeed, despite Metz’s relegation from the French top flight last season, the £1.8m-rated talent still managed to catch the eye over his nine Ligue 1 appearances in 2021/22, helping his side keep one clean sheet, registering one assist and creating one big chance for his teammates, as well as making an average of 1.2 tackles, 0.6 interceptions and taking 0.7 shots per game.

These returns have generated a great deal of interest in the teenager’s services this summer, with Atalanta, Eintracht Frankfurt, Cologne and Stuttgart all reported to be keen on the youngster, alongside the likes of Leeds and Hamburger.

Furthermore, according to FBref, the £1k-per-week defender also ranks in the top 23% of full-backs in Europe’s big five leagues and European competitions for assists per 90, in addition to the top 18% for pressures, the top 24% for shots, the top 38% for dribbles completed and the top 43% for progressive carries over the last 365 days.

These metrics see FBref list Norwich City’s £20m-valued Max Aarons – the 22-year-old right-back who has been linked with both Barcelona and Bayern Munich following a number of impressive campaigns with the Canaries – as Mikelbrencis’ most comparable player. It is clear to see why considering that England U21 international also particularly impresses in dribbles completed, progressive carries and pressures over the past 12 months.

As such, should Orta manage to get a deal for the France U18 international over the line this summer, the Spaniard could well have unearthed the new Aarons for Leeds – a prospect that is sure to delight the Elland Road faithful and Jesse Marsch alike.
